SX 8663 MARLDON

13/73 The Old School House and cottages

Gv II

Former village school and schoolmaster's house now divided into cottages. Circa 1840, Stone rubble. Slate roof with stone coping to gable ends. The school at the right hand (west) end is single storeyed and has five chamfered stone cross-mullion transom windows and left hand doorway in chamfered opening with polygonal head incorporating a square fanlight above. Projecting chimney stack with set-offs at centre of front. Lean-to at west end with gabled porch and small stone gabled bellcote over end gable above. Gabled crosswing at opposite (east) end is the schoolmaster's house with chamfered window opening on each floor, ground floor two-lights, first floor single light and small slit in gable above. East front three bays centre advanced slightly with chamfered corners.
